Abstract

The invention discloses rosin processing equipment and a processing method thereof. A dissolving tank, a high-position pot, a clarifying tank and a distillation tank are sequentially connected; the dissolving tank and the distillation tank are respectively communicated with a steam tank through a connecting pipe, the dissolving tank is connected with a rosin inlet, the bottom of the distillation tank is provided with a rosin discharging groove connected with a rosin storage tank, the top of the distillation tank is connected with a condenser, the condenser is connected with an oil-water separator, and the middle upper part of the oil-water separator is connected with a turpentine oil storage tank. By improving the structure of the dissolving tank, the dissolving tank is uniformly heated, rosin can be quickly and completely dissolved, and the prepared rosin is lighter in color and higher in product purity. The provided distillation tank not only can improve the distillation efficiency and reduce the energy consumption, but also can prevent rosin from being carbonized or cracked to influence the rosin quality; the rosin and the turpentine can be better separated from rosin liquid, so that the yield of the rosin and the turpentine is increased, and the economic benefit is increased.

Background technique [0002] Rosin, also known as turpentine, is the distilled resin contained in pine trees. It is solid and transparent in appearance, light yellow or brown in color, hard and brittle, insoluble in water and soluble in alcohol. Rosin has the advantages of large output, renewable, biodegradable, etc., and has a stable rigid structure, so it can replace petrochemical aromatic ring raw materials and become an important raw material for the preparation of functional new materials.
